‘Marking Time’ reception is February 6

Scripps College’s Denison Library and Clark Humanities Museum host a free and open to the public reception for April Katz’s exhibit, “Marking Time,” at 5 p.m. Thursday, February 6 at Clark Humanities Museum, 981 Amherst Ave., Claremont.

Katz, the Morrill Professor Emeritus at Iowa State University, has exhibited throughout the U.S. for more than 30 years, including at the Fogg Museum at Harvard University and the Corcoran Gallery of Art in Washington, D.C.

The exhibit runs through February 19. The museum is open weekdays from 8:30 a.m. to 12:30 p.m., closes for lunch, then reopens from 1:30 to 4:30 p.m. Admission is free.
